The Role of Media in Society
The media plays a crucial role in shaping public opinion, culture, and social behavior. As a powerful tool for communication and information dissemination, media influences various aspects of society, from politics and education to entertainment and social norms. This article explores the role of media in society, its impact, and the responsibilities that come with media power.The Functions of Media
Information and EducationMedia serves as a primary source of information for the public, covering news, events, and developments locally and globally. It also plays an educational role by providing documentaries, educational programs, and informative content that enhance public knowledge and awareness.
EntertainmentMedia provides entertainment through various formats, including television shows, movies, music, and online content. Entertainment media has a significant impact on cultural trends and social norms.
Public Opinion ShapingMedia has the power to shape public opinion by influencing perceptions, attitudes, and beliefs. The framing of news stories, editorials, and commentary can impact how people understand and respond to issues.
Watchdog RoleMedia acts as a watchdog, holding individuals, corporations, and governments accountable for their actions. Investigative journalism plays a crucial role in exposing corruption, injustice, and unethical behavior.
Social IntegrationMedia helps to integrate societies by promoting shared values, norms, and cultural practices. It provides a platform for diverse voices and perspectives, fostering social cohesion and understanding.
The Impact of Media on Society
Political InfluenceMedia significantly influences political processes by informing the public about policies, candidates, and elections. It also provides a platform for political debate and discussion. However, media bias and the spread of misinformation can distort public perception and affect democratic processes.
Cultural ImpactMedia shapes cultural norms and values by highlighting certain lifestyles, behaviors, and ideals. It influences fashion, language, and social interactions, contributing to the development of popular culture.
Social BehaviorMedia can impact social behavior by promoting certain behaviors and discouraging others. For example, public health campaigns in the media can encourage healthy behaviors, while exposure to violent content can influence aggressive behavior.
Economic EffectsMedia plays a significant role in the economy by driving consumer behavior through advertising and marketing. It also supports the entertainment and information industries, contributing to economic growth and job creation.
Technological AdvancementsThe evolution of media technology, from print to digital platforms, has transformed how people consume information. Social media and online platforms have created new opportunities for communication, content creation, and information sharing.
Responsibilities of Media
Accuracy and ObjectivityMedia organizations have a responsibility to provide accurate and objective information. Fact-checking and unbiased reporting are essential to maintaining public trust and credibility.
Ethical StandardsEthical journalism involves respecting privacy, avoiding sensationalism, and being sensitive to the impact of reporting on individuals and communities. Ethical standards help ensure responsible and respectful media practices.
Diversity and InclusionMedia should strive to represent diverse voices and perspectives, promoting inclusion and equality. This involves providing a platform for underrepresented groups and addressing issues of bias and discrimination.
AccountabilityMedia organizations should be accountable for their content and actions. This includes being transparent about sources, correcting errors, and being open to feedback and criticism.
Public ServiceMedia has a public service role, providing information that serves the public interest and contributes to the well-being of society. This includes covering important issues, promoting civic engagement, and supporting community initiatives.
Conclusion
The role of media in society is multifaceted and influential. It serves as a source of information, entertainment, and education, while also shaping public opinion, culture, and social behavior. With this power comes great responsibility, as media organizations must uphold ethical standards, promote diversity, and ensure accuracy and accountability. By fulfilling these responsibilities, media can positively contribute to the development and well-being of society.
